DNSCrypt: Difference between revisions

From NixOS Wiki
imported>Fadenb
m Syntaxhighlight
imported>Emily
article uses old version of dnscrypt-proxy; redirect to more generic article that has information on the Go rewrite
 
(One intermediate revision by one other user not shown)
Line 1: Line 1:
Usually DNS is not encrypted and unauthenticated by default. Some countries or provider may change the result of domain resolution.
#REDIRECT [[Encrypted DNS]]
 
= Enable DNSCrypt =
 
The following snippet will enable DNSCrypt and set it as the default system resolver.
 
<syntaxhighlight lang="nix">{ # configuration.nix
  services.dnscrypt-proxy = {
    enable = true;
    # the official default resolver is unreliable from time to time
    # either use a different, trust-worthy one from here:
    #  https://github.com/jedisct1/dnscrypt-proxy/blob/master/dnscrypt-resolvers.csv
    # or setup your own.
    #resolverName = "cs-de";
  };
  networking.nameservers = ["127.0.0.1"];
}</syntaxhighlight>

Latest revision as of 20:32, 17 April 2020

Redirect to: